Ticket: Staging env misconfigured for Siftgate bloom filter

The bloom layer in front of the Pellet KV store is rejecting all lookups in staging because the env file was copied from the dev template without credentials. False-positive tuning values are fine; only the auth line is missing. To unblock the weekly demo, the Pellet admission secret must be set on the following line.

env line for yaguf-fajop: LEDGER_TOKEN13=fb08984397349

### Ledgerline Billing Worker — v4.1.0

- Enabled blue-green deploys; green pool drains in-flight invoices before cutover.
- Added health gate: no traffic shift until queue lag under 5s.
- Rollback is one command; see runbook in the deploys folder.
- Removed the old rolling-restart script.

Contractors: do not deploy manually. All cutovers require approval from the deploy owner named below.

account owner for bawip-tahag: Raleth Quenok

**Mgmt Meeting Minutes — Retiring the Brightline Range**

Quick recap for sales leads at Fenholt Supplies: we agreed to retire the Brightline fixture range by year-end. Remaining stock moves to clearance pricing next month, and accounts on standing orders get migrated to the Lumetta range. Trade-in incentives were approved in principle. The confidential note on next steps sits just below.

board note of bajof-bajeg: The pricing group signed off on a budget of $13.4 million for Project Sildor. The renewal with Lamixek Holdings closes at $48.9 million a year, 49 percent above the last contract.

Ticket: Contrast audit pipeline failing on staging. The Huebright audit job was pointed at the production theme tokens, so WCAG contrast checks passed on staging even where the staging palette fails. Fixed the endpoint in audit.conf, but the job still can't pull token manifests because the staging env was never given credentials. To unblock, the manifest fetch token must be set in staging's .env directly after this line.

vault entry, yajop-bafop: ARCHIVE_KEY3=8d4